SW1 L4-1.9L SOHC VIN 8 (1996)
Catalytic Converter: Service and Repair
Front Exhaust Pipe to Three Way Catalytic Converter
Removal
CAUTION: MAKE SURE VEHICLE IS PROPERLY SUPPORTED AND SQUARELY POSITION. TO HELP AVOID PERSONAL INJURY
WHEN A VEHICLE IS ON A HOIST, PROVIDE ADDITIONAL SUPPORT FOR THE VEHICLE ON THE OPPOSITE END FROM
WHICH COMPONENTS ARE BEING REMOVED. MAKE SURE HOIST DOES NOT CONTACT FUEL OR BRAKE LINES.
NOTE: There will neither be a service converter nor a service front pipe for 1996 Saturns. When service is needed to either the front exhaust pipe or the
catalytic converter on 1996 Saturns, both pieces must be replaced as a unit.
FRONT EXHAUST PIPE TO THREE WAY CATALYTIC CONVERTER REMOVAL
Vehicle Lifting
1. Raise vehicle squarely on a lift.
NOTE: Do not apply grease or silicon products to the rear heated oxygen sensor. Do not alter the wiring in any way. The wires carry air reference
to the sensor.
2. Remove rear heated oxygen sensor wiring harness from cradle by pushing up on retaining clip tab.
